United Healthcare (UHC) insurance company offers some plans with hearing aid benefits. As stated, not all plans have these benefits and it is important to research your plan and benefits. Gardner Audiology audiologists are UHC providers and our staff is well versed in verification of benefits.
Some plans have a full benefit and will cover a pair of premium hearing aids. Other plans have a set benefit amount that can be used toward the purchase of hearing aids. Others are subject to deductibles and copayments while others are not.
UHC Medicare replacement plans offer cheap, mail order hearing aids. This goes against Florida regulations prohibiting mail order hearing aids. Hearing aids that have not been properly adjusted can result in further problems, not limited to worsening your hearing. All hearing aids (including the UHC/HiHealth hearing aids) should be properly fitted, in person, by a licensed Florida hearing aid professional. For most, education and counseling are an integral part of successful adaptation to new hearing aids.
